#c8c100 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#c8c100 is composed of 78.4% red, 75.7% green and 0%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 3.5% magenta, 100% yellow and 21.6% black. It has a hue angle of 57.9 degrees, a saturation of 100% and a lightness of 39.2%. #c8c100 color hex could be obtained by blending #ffff00 with #918300. Closest websafe color is: #cccc00.

Shades and Tints of #c8c100

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#040400 is the darkest color, while #fffeef is the lightest one.

Tones of #c8c100

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#6c6b5c is the less saturated color, while #c8c100 is the most saturated one.
